Python示范法:PIPA-Demo-1的实践与应用

需积分: 9 0 下载量 25 浏览量 更新于2024-12-29 收藏 2KB ZIP 举报
知识点: 1. Python编程语言: Python是一种广泛使用的高级编程语言,其特点是代码简洁易读。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。Python的设计哲学强调代码的可读性和简洁的语法,非常适合快速应用程序开发。 2. 编程示范法: 示范法,也就是通过实例演示的方法,是教学和学习中常用的技术之一。在编程领域,示范法通常指的是通过具体的代码示例来展示某个概念或技术的应用。这种方法有助于理解理论概念,并在实际编程实践中加以应用。 3. 示例程序分析: 根据文件描述,PIPA-Demo-1 包含了一个具体的Python示例程序,可能用于演示某个特定的编程概念或技术。通过分析这个示例程序,学习者可以更好地理解如何在实际中运用Python解决问题,例如数据处理、算法实现或自动化任务等。 4. 文件结构: 文件名为“PIPA-Demo-1-demo1”,这意味着它是一个针对PIPA-Demo-1项目的演示版本,很可能包含了简化的代码示例。文件名称中的“demo1”表明它可能是系列演示中的第一个,或者是一个基础演示,用于介绍核心概念。 5. 理论与实践的结合: 示范法将理论知识与实际代码编写相结合,这对于学习者理解概念和技能至关重要。理论部分可以为编程实践提供背景知识和原理,而实践则帮助学习者加深理解,并能够将所学知识应用于解决实际问题。 6. Python在教学中的应用: Python由于其易学易用的特性,在教学领域被广泛用作入门级编程语言。使用Python进行示范法教学可以让初学者更快地掌握编程基础,并能迅速过渡到更高级的主题。 7. 编程实践的价值: 在学习编程时,仅仅了解理论是不够的,通过实际编写代码,可以验证理论的正确性,并且能够发现新的问题和解决方案。这种实践过程有助于培养逻辑思维和解决问题的能力。 8. 项目导向学习(Problem-Oriented Learning): PIPA-Demo-1 可能是一个项目导向学习的案例,这种学习方式以项目为中心,通过解决实际问题来学习编程。项目导向学习能够帮助学习者更好地理解课程内容,并促进自主学习和团队合作。 9. 文件压缩包子: 虽然文件压缩包子听起来像是一个特定的术语,但在这里,它可能仅仅指的是被压缩的文件包,其中包含了演示程序的代码文件。这表明资源是经过组织打包,并准备好提供给用户下载或使用。 10. Python环境搭建: 在开始编写或运行Python代码之前,通常需要搭建合适的编程环境。这可能包括安装Python解释器、开发工具和相关库。一个良好的编程环境对于顺利进行编程实践至关重要。 通过上述知识点,我们可以看出PIPA-Demo-1:示范法项目着重于通过Python编程语言的实际应用来展示编程概念,并强调理论知识与实践的结合。这不仅能够帮助初学者更好地理解编程原理,还能够提高他们解决实际问题的能力。此外,该资源还涉及到项目导向学习方法,通过解决具体问题来学习编程,这种方法通常更加有效,因为它更贴近实际工作中的应用场景。